Are there any special eligibility requirements for B.Sc in Astronomy course?

No, there are no specific eligibility requirements to pursue a BSc in Astronomy and Astrophysics program. You just need to pass Class 12 in the Science stream with a minimum of 50% aggregate score from a recognised board. There may be some relaxation for reserved categories.
